Informational

Security: Password has been changed for

 

user <username> from <session-id>

Password of the specified user has been changed during the specified session ID or type. <session-id>can be console, telnet, ssh, web, or snmp.

Informational

<user-name>login to PRIVILEGED mode

A user has logged into the Privileged EXEC

 

 

mode of the CLI.

 

 

The <user-name>is the user name.

 

 

 

Informational

<user-name>login to USER EXEC mode

A user has logged into the USER EXEC mode

 

 

of the CLI.

 

 

The <user-name>is the user name.

 

 

 

Informational

<user-name>logout from PRIVILEGED mode

A user has logged out of Privileged EXEC

 

 

mode of the CLI.

 

 

The <user-name>is the user name.

 

 

 

Informational

<user-name>logout from USER EXEC mode

A user has logged out of the USER EXEC

 

 

mode of the CLI.

 

 

The <user-name>is the user name.

Informational

Bridge root changed, vlan <vlan-id>, new

 

root ID <string>, root interface <portnum>

A Spanning Tree Protocol (STP) topology change has occurred.

The <vlan-id>is the ID of the VLAN in which the STP topology change occurred.

The <root-id>is the STP bridge root ID. The <portnum> is the number of the port connected to the new root bridge.
